[client] Serialize Android tunnel reconfiguration callbacks

The Android route notifier and the DNS search-domain notifier both
delivered OnNetworkChanged from a fire-and-forget goroutine per update.
Two updates in quick succession could reach the Java side reordered:
the TUN rebuild handler applies them in arrival order and compares
against the last applied parameters, so a stale route set delivered
last won as the final TUN state. This is the same reordering hazard
fixed for iOS in #6454.

Wrap the Android network change listener into the shared tunnelnotifier
FIFO introduced in #6870, the same way RunOniOS does, and deliver both
notifiers synchronously into it. Enqueueing is non-blocking, a single
delivery goroutine preserves order, and calls into Java never overlap.

Also stop hasRouteDiff from sorting the notifier's shared route slices
in place; compare sorted copies instead.
